to help the civil rights movement. She was struck in the head March 25, 1965, by shots fired from a passing car. Her Black passenger, 19-year-old Leroy Moton, was wounded.Liuzzo's murder followed"Bloody Sunday," a civil rights march in which protesters were beaten, trampled and tear-gassed by police at the Edmund Pettus Bridge in Selma, Alabama.
Images of the violence during the first march shocked the U.S. and turned up the pressure to pass the Voting Rights Act of 1965, which helped open voter rolls to millions of Black people in the South.for Alabama, Liuzzo told her husband it"was everybody's fight" and asked Evans"to help care for her five young children during her brief absence," according to script on the monument.
Tyrone Green Sr., Evans' grandson, told a small crowd at Thursday's unveiling that the monument is"unbelievable."
